Malvertising is one of the latest trends circulating and is difficult to prevent. Ads on legitimate websites are the carrier of a malvertising infection. Users do not have to click on the ad to be infected. Many times scammers run a clean ad on a legitimate website and after a period of time inject malware into the ad. Just visiting the site can cause a malware infection.
How Can I Stop Malvertising?
One of the quickest and easiest ways to protect your computer from malvertising is the installation of ad blocking software. Adguard and Adblock offer free and paid versions which will block ads when you visit a website.
Two Free Programs That Keep Your Computer Clean
CCleaner and Malwarebytes are two free programs every computer owner should consider. Both programs are highly rated, easy to install, easy to use and help ensure the integrity of your computer.
CCleaner is a registry and junk cleaner plus optimizes the performance of your computer. If you spend a lot of time surfing the web and visiting different sites CCleaner can clear your cache with a simple keystroke. The program can be customized with ease choosing which browsers to optimize and which functions and features should apply to your system specifications.
Malwarebytes is a niche program which targets the prevention, detection and the ability to destroy malicious malware infections. The program is also easy to install with no muss or fuss and delivers what it promises.
Why Do I Need Both Programs If I Have Anti Virus Software?
In my experience, an anti virus program plus CCleaner and Malawarebytes provide a triple threat to protect your computer. CCleaner and Malawarebytes are small niche programs which not only supplement but detect issues an anti virus program does not. Computer users, including myself, are lax in cleaning their cache and deleting temporary files and cookies. CCleaner is one click of a button from your desktop. CCleaner probably completes its’ task with a click of the mouse quicker than manually going through the steps to clean the cache yourself.
